* fix(design-system): DS::Button a11y audit
Closes#1738. Four concrete fixes surfaced by the savings-goals
audit + #1737 universal checklist:
1. Focus ring (WCAG 2.4.7). `base.css` had
`focus-visible:outline-gray-900` which is **1.07:1** against the
primary button's gray-900 background — invisible. Widen to
`outline-2 outline-offset-2`, place outline outside the button
via offset, and add a dark-mode `outline-white` so the ring is
always visible against the page chrome regardless of the button
surface.
2. Touch target (WCAG 2.5.5). Icon-only buttons at the default
`:md` size were `w-9 h-9` = 36×36, below the 44×44 enhanced
target. Bump `md.icon_container_classes` to `w-11 h-11` and
`lg.icon_container_classes` to `w-12 h-12` to keep the size
scale intact. `sm` stays at 32×32 (already passes WCAG 2.5.8
AA's 24×24 minimum; intentional compact-density variant).
3. Default button type. `content_tag(:button, ...)` inherits the
HTML default `type="submit"`, so a DS::Button rendered inside a
form steals Enter-key submission from the first text input
(reproducible in the form stepper). Default to `type="button"`
in the non-`href` branch; existing form submitters pass
`type: "submit"` explicitly and continue to work. The `button_to`
(href) branch keeps the submit default because button_to wraps
its own form.
4. Icon-only accessible name. Icon-only buttons render no text
node, so AT users hear "button" with no name. Derive a
humanized aria-label from the icon key (e.g. `icon: "more-horizontal"`
→ `aria-label="More horizontal"`); explicit
`aria: { label: }` on the caller still wins. Soft fallback —
callers should still pass meaningful labels for richer copy.
Plus: replace the stale `fg-white` icon class on the destructive
variant with `text-inverse` (the `fg-*` namespace was deprecated
in #1626 so `fg-white` resolved to nothing; the icon was using its
helper-default color rather than the white the design intended).
Out of scope:
- Menu avatar trigger (custom 36×36 button bypassing DS::Button) —
belongs to #1743 DS::Menu audit.
- DS::FilledIcon `lg` size container (decorative, not interactive)
— belongs to #1742.
* fix(design-system): force type=submit on StyledFormBuilder#submit
The DS::Button default-type-button change in the previous commit
broke every `form.submit "Log in"` callsite because
`StyledFormBuilder#submit` (app/helpers/styled_form_builder.rb)
renders a DS::Button under the hood with no explicit `type:`.
After the default flip, those submit buttons rendered as
`type="button"`, so submitting forms (login, password reset, every
form using `form.submit`) silently no-ops. CI surfaced this via
~30 system tests failing in the `sign_in` helper, which couldn't
get past the login page.
Pin `type: "submit"` on the DS::Button rendered by
`StyledFormBuilder#submit`. The 22 view-level `f.submit` /
`render DS::Button.new(type: :submit, ...)` callers already pass
type explicitly and are unaffected.
* fix(review): href-branch type-button bug + focus-ring tokens + profile Save submit
CodeRabbit P1+P2 review on #1840:
1. button.rb: `merged_opts.delete(:href)` always returned nil because
Buttonish#initialize strips :href from opts into @href, so the
`if href.blank?` guard was ALWAYS true. Every DS::Button rendered via
button_to (the href branch) got `type="button"` on the inner button,
breaking submission of those button_to-generated forms (e.g.
imports/_ready.html.erb publish button, imports/_failure.html.erb
try-again button). Drop the local `href = merged_opts.delete(:href)`
so the guard now reads the @href reader, leaving the href branch's
HTML default intact.
2. settings/profiles/show.html.erb: the Save button is rendered with
`render DS::Button.new(...)` inside `styled_form_with` (not via
form.submit), so the StyledFormBuilder#submit type-pin from
624e9794 doesn't cover it. Pass `type: :submit` explicitly so the
profile form submits again under the default-type-button policy.
3. base.css: replace raw `outline-gray-900` / `outline-white` with the
established alpha-ring focus pattern
(focus-visible:ring-alpha-black-300 + theme-dark:ring-alpha-white-300)
already used by app/components/settings/provider_card.html.erb and
sure-design-system/components.css. Keeps a11y focus ring while using
DS tokens.
* fix(review): add type: :submit to DS::Button submitters inside forms
CI test_system on #1840 surfaced 6 failures (confirm-dialog close,
property create/edit, transaction filter apply) caused by the same
gap that db563f3d started addressing: the default-type-button policy
on DS::Button means every \`render DS::Button.new(...)\` inside a
\`<form>\` (or \`styled_form_with\`) that relies on the HTML default to
submit is now an inert \`type="button"\`.
Audited every \`render DS::Button.new(\` callsite repo-wide for the
combination (no \`type:\`, no \`href:\`, inside a form context) and
pinned \`type: :submit\` explicitly on the 12 forms that need it:
- layouts/shared/_confirm_dialog.html.erb: Confirm button inside the
global \`<form method=\"dialog\">\` — fixes
test_should_allow_revoking_API_key_with_confirmation.
- properties/{new,edit,balances}.html.erb: Save/Next submitter inside
\`styled_form_with\` — fixes test_can_create_property_account,
test_can_persist_property_subtype.
- transactions/searches/_menu.html.erb: Apply inside the filter form —
fixes test_can_filter_uncategorized_transactions,
test_all_filters_work_and_empty_state_shows_if_no_match,
test_can_open_filters_and_apply_one_or_more.
- transactions/bulk_updates/new.html.erb: Save in bulk-edit drawer.
- account_sharings/show.html.erb: Save in account-sharing form.
- category/deletions/new.html.erb, tag/deletions/new.html.erb:
destructive + safe submit buttons in deletion dialog forms.
- family_merchants/merge.html.erb: Submit in merge form.
- subscriptions/upgrade.html.erb: contribute_and_support_sure submit.
- rules/_category_rule_cta.html.erb: Dismiss inside the
rule_prompts_disabled form.
Cancel/close DS::Button instances inside these same forms intentionally
keep the \`type=button\` default since they drive JS-only actions
(\`DS--dialog#close\`, \`DS--menu#close\`).
